An interesting concept was revealed for WWE Bragging Rights on Raw. It was said that the matches would be SmackDown Vs Raw. Basically they would fight for their shows Bragging Rights. I think this is a great idea because it gives the WWE a chance to have some good new matches as well as repeat some old classics. There a few matches in mind that I would love to see. Chris Jericho(SmackDown) Vs Shawn Michaels(Raw)

Display_image

The picture says that Jericho frowns upon your stupidity. Well I think we are smart enough to realize a good match when we see it and this would definately be one of those.

I'm sure everyone remembers that amazing feud with Chris Jericho and Shawn Michaels in 2008. It was that very same feud that turned Chris from that funny face everyone loves. To that dispicible heel everyone loves to hate.

They had many great clashes and had some very interesting stuff happen in the feud. You had Jericho throwing Shawn through a Jeri-tron. You had Chris punch Shawn's wife. You had an unsanctioned match. And who could forget that epic Ladder Match between Shawn and Chris? It was amazing!

To see these two face off against would be a great pleasure. And if it's even half as amazing as their feud was it'll be great. Not really sure who would take it home for their brand, but I would hope it's Chris Jericho. Why? Because he is the best in the world today!

Two of the better tag team in the WWE at the moment are Legacy and Hart Dynasty. Legacy consists of Ted Dibiase and Cody Rhodes. Meanwhile Hart Dynasty consists of Tyson Kidd and David Hart Smith.

Over the past few months Legacy has had their hands full with DX. Last night at Hell In A Cell. DX destroyed them and took them out of action for the time being. It seems like that feud has ended with Legacy going home with bruises.

Basically since DX has moved on Legacy can too. So at Bragging Rights it would be cool to see Hart Dynasty face off against Legacy. I think Legacy should take it just as a second prize. Instead of beating DX they can beat the Hart Dynasty. First prize is still better, but what can you do?
